/**
* This file contains the shared types for the machine learning component. The intended
* use is for defining types to be used in JSDoc. They are used in a form that the
* TypeScript language server can read them, and provide code hints.
*
*/
import { type PipelineOptions } from "chrome://global/content/ml/EngineProcess.sys.mjs";
import { MLEngine } from "./actors/MLEngineParent.sys.mjs";
export type EngineStatus =
// The engine is waiting for a previous one to shut down.
| "SHUTTING_DOWN_PREVIOUS_ENGINE"
// The engine dispatcher has been created, and the engine is still initializing.
| "INITIALIZING"
// The engine is fully ready and idle.
| "IDLE"
// The engine is currently processing a run request.
| "RUNNING"
// The engine is in the process of terminating, but hasn't fully shut down.
| "TERMINATING"
// The engine has been fully terminated and removed.
| "TERMINATED";
